The 2021 Bellamy is more Cabernet Sauvignon-dominated yet includes 15% Merlot and 9% Cabernet Franc that will see 22 months in 60% new barrels. Cassis, currants, leafy herbs, and tobacco all emerge on the nose, and this puppy is full-bodied, layered, and concentrated, with a deep, rich mouthfeel. I love its tannins, and this is going to shine for at least two decades.Range: 96-98 The 2021 Cabernet Sauvignon Bellamy is spicy, displaying an intense blend of savory herbs, curry leaf and black currant. It soothes with its ripe red and black fruits and vibrant acidity, while a saline mineral tinge adds contrast and inner violet tones cascade throughout. Long and staining with a sweet licorice and hard candy resonance, the 2021 tapers off structured yet amazingly fresh. A rich, dark and flavorful red showing an array of black berries, iodine, tea leaves and olives on the nose. It's full-bodied, firm and focused, with broad tannins that envelop the wine.
